The Transit celebrates its 40th year on the Irish market as the countrys
best selling commercial vehicle. Last year, the Ford mainstay claimed
an 11 per cent share of the entire market, with sales more than double
those of its nearest competitor. Completing a hat-trick for the blue oval,
the Fiesta van and the Focus van were the most popular models in their
respective segments.
In total, 4,684 Transit units were sold last year, more than twice that
of the Volkswagen Transporter and Nissan Primastar. Introduced in early
2005, the Focus van took the number one spot in its segment. With sales
of 487 units, it pipped the VW Golf and Toyota Corolla. Meanwhile, the
Fiesta van was the best-selling commercial super-mini on the
market, ahead of the Peugeot 206.

In the dedicated sub 1-tonne segment, the Transit Connect strongly outpaced
the market with sales up 65 per cent to 1,435. Overall, Ford sales rose
to 6,821 units, or 16 per cent of the market.
As referred to by Clive, the Transit is available in a wide range of models.
The Transit van offers short, medium or long wheelbase and front or rear
wheel drive, plus three roof heights for ultimate flexibility. Prices
start from a very affordable EUR20,690 and a special edition Transit Legend
is currently on the market.

The smaller Transit Connect comes in short and long wheelbases and has
a starting price of EUR14,335. The Transit Minibus can seat either 15
or 17 passengers, while the Tourneo is a more compact nine-seater.
The Transit Chassis Cab is available in short, medium, long and extended
frame wheelbases and can be built to the customers specification.
The Ford Ranger is built on a rugged ladder frame chassis and comes in
a wide range of cab styles, as well as a choice of two- or four-wheel
drive. This vehicle is a real workhorse and starts from EUR24,645.
